Description
Caol Ila's 12-year-old from the 1980s represents the distillery in its role as a classic blending malt, before it became celebrated for single-malt releases. The profile shows restrained peat smoke with briny maritime notes and a subtle sweetness from the ex-bourbon maturation. Medium-bodied with a clean, dry finish that demonstrates Islay's characteristic seaweed and salt without overwhelming richness. A window into how this workhorse malt contributed to some of Scotland's finest blended whiskies.
